Samenvatting

David F. Labaree has spent the last twenty years researching, thinking and writing about some of the key and enduring issues in the history of education and education policy and politics. Here, he brings together twelve of his key writings in one place. Starting with a specially written introduction, 'Getting It Wrong', which gives an ironic overview of how the ideas in his work have evolved over time and throws light on the process of scholarly production, the chapters cover such topics as: the structure of the educational system conflicting purposes of education the core problems of practice in teaching and teacher education barriers to curriculum reform.

An ideal resource for anyone wanting to know more about the development of schools and schooling and David Labaree's contribution to these important fields.
